How they compare

Jordan currently reports 29.71 current US$ per square kilometre against 27.51 current US$ per square kilometre in Senegal, a difference of 2.2 current US$ per square kilometre.

That makes Jordan's figure about 1.1 times Senegal's.

The two have swapped places 18 times across 54 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Jordan ahead.

Jordan ranks 51st and Senegal ranks 53rd of 140 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Jordan averaged higher in 3 and Senegal in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Jordan Senegal Difference Ahead
1970s 3.31 current US$ per square kilometre 1.66 current US$ per square kilometre 1.65 current US$ per square kilometre Jordan
1980s 3.84 current US$ per square kilometre 9.34 current US$ per square kilometre 5.5 current US$ per square kilometre Senegal
1990s 21.33 current US$ per square kilometre 21.14 current US$ per square kilometre 0.1834 current US$ per square kilometre Jordan
2000s 10.47 current US$ per square kilometre 18.42 current US$ per square kilometre 7.95 current US$ per square kilometre Senegal
2010s 28.09 current US$ per square kilometre 26.16 current US$ per square kilometre 1.93 current US$ per square kilometre Jordan
2020s 30.17 current US$ per square kilometre 32.24 current US$ per square kilometre 2.07 current US$ per square kilometre Senegal

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
